Question
- as the non - metallic properties of atoms increase, the electronegativity will _i_, and as the molar mass of atoms in the same group increase, electronegativity will _ii_.
the statement above is best completed by the information in row
row i ii
□ decrease decrease
□ decrease increase
□ increase increase
□ increase decrease
Step1: Relationship between non - metallic properties and electronegativity
Non - metallic properties of an atom are related to its ability to attract electrons. As non - metallic properties increase, the atom's ability to attract electrons (electronegativity) increases.
Step2: Relationship between molar mass (atomic size in a group) and electronegativity
In a group of the periodic table, as the molar mass (which is related to atomic size, as molar mass increases, atomic size generally increases) of atoms increases, the distance between the nucleus and the outermost electrons increases. The effective nuclear charge acting on the outermost electrons decreases. So, the atom's ability to attract electrons (electronegativity) decreases.
